From the Original Trilogy or an Alternate Timeline?

As Snipes took center stage again, he claimed, “There's only been one Blade. There will only ever be one Blade.” Yet, while fans assumed this was the Blade they knew and loved, some evidence suggests otherwise. Whisperings have suggested that Snipes' Blade might originate from an alternate timeline, deviating from our known Blade trilogy.

This theory itself in a deleted scene from the first Blade film back in 1998. The scene, found on YouTube, features Morbius, quite the unusual character from Sony's Marvel Universe.

Deleted Scene Sparks Speculation

In this elusive scene, Morbius lurks in the background as Blade and Karen discuss vampire hunting on a rooftop. Initially planned as the chief antagonist for Blade's , Morbius' appearance was eventually scrapped. Now this deleted content could be setting an alternate universe stage. Here, Blade is compelled to kill his maker- Morbius. This action disrupts the timeline, where Morbius was an integral anchor. This disruption could lead the Time Variance Authority (TVA) to intervene, sending this ‘new' Blade into the void.

Let's be clear – this is merely speculation. However, the multiverse structure of the MCU does lend credence to such wildcard theories.

A Record-Breaking Return

Wesley Snipes' cameo wasn't just a surprise; it was a record-breaker. He now holds the title for the longest gap between character appearances in Marvel films and the longest portrayal of a Marvel character in live-action. Yet, despite these achievements, Snipes was initially skeptical about returning.

The admitted to Entertainment Weekly, “I did not think it was possible. I didn't think we would be able to pull it off…” Yet, after receiving a call from his former Blade: Trinity co-star, Ryan Reynolds, he knew he had to reconsider.

Ryan Reynold's Nudges a Comeback

Known for his role as Marvel's irreverent Deadpool, Reynolds reached out to Snipes, highlighting the potential of this unique opportunity. This communication led to an unforgettable Marvel moment – Snipes reprising his role as Blade.
